2005 Nissan Almera vs. 2004 Skoda Superb

To start off, 2005 Nissan Almera is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2004 Skoda Superb.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2004 Skoda Superb would be higher. At 1,896 cc (4 cylinders), 2004 Skoda Superb is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Nissan Almera (114 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 1 more horse power than 2004 Skoda Superb. (113 HP @ 5400 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Nissan Almera should accelerate faster than 2004 Skoda Superb.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Skoda Superb weights approximately 235 kg more than 2005 Nissan Almera.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2004 Skoda Superb (172 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 9 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Nissan Almera. (163 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2004 Skoda Superb will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Nissan Almera.
